  • The M7 was a blast mine that was used by the United States during World War II. Officially known as an anti-vehicle mine due to the fact that it was not able to penetrate a tank's armor, the M7 was placed by first moving the fuze into position, then removing the safety pin. It was then armed and activated by the means of a pressure plate. When the mine was activated, the pressure plate pushed a plunger down in order to smash a small glass vial of acid that then reacted with another chemical in order to activate the detonator.
